Hilbre Island Lighthouse
Position 53 23.0 N 03 13.7 W

Hilbre Island Lighthouse provides a port land mark for the Hilbre swash in the River Dee estuary.

This small automatic lighthouse came under the full jurisdiction of Trinity House in 1973, before this it was operated by the Mersey Docks and Harbour Board Authority.

Hilbre Island Lighthouse was converted from acetylene gas to solar powered operation in 1995.

Specifications

Established 1927
Height Of Tower 3 Metres
Height Of Light Above Mean High Water 14 Metres
Character Red Flash Every 3 Seconds
Intensity 13,500 Candela
Range Of Light 5 nautical miles
